[SCM] WebKit Debian packaging branch, debian/experimental, updated. upstream/1.3.3-9427-gc2be6fc
commit-queue at webkit.org
commit-queue at webkit.org
Wed Dec 22 12:54:49 UTC 2010
The following commit has been merged in the debian/experimental branch:
commit 7a1ec1623c5e31cc33399f594c932eece7bd01ab
Author: commit-queue at webkit.org <commit-queue at webkit.org@268f45cc-cd09-0410-ab3c-d52691b4dbfc>
Date: Wed Sep 1 16:34:18 2010 +0000
2010-09-01 Ryuan Choi <ryuan.choi at samsung.com>
Reviewed by Antonio Gomes.
[EFL] Need to check LibSoup version
https://bugs.webkit.org/show_bug.cgi?id=44658
Add version check of LibSoup.
* cmake/FindLibSoup2.cmake:
git-svn-id: http://svn.webkit.org/repository/webkit/trunk@66609 268f45cc-cd09-0410-ab3c-d52691b4dbfc
diff --git a/ChangeLog b/ChangeLog
index 06d4b48..c75cc87 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,14 @@
+2010-09-01 Ryuan Choi <ryuan.choi at samsung.com>
+
+ Reviewed by Antonio Gomes.
+
+ [EFL] Need to check LibSoup version
+ https://bugs.webkit.org/show_bug.cgi?id=44658
+
+ Add version check of LibSoup.
+
+ * cmake/FindLibSoup2.cmake:
+
2010-08-31 Gustavo Noronha Silva <gustavo.noronha at collabora.co.uk>
Reviewed by Martin Robinson.
diff --git a/cmake/FindLibSoup2.cmake b/cmake/FindLibSoup2.cmake
index 955066c..e023a63 100644
--- a/cmake/FindLibSoup2.cmake
+++ b/cmake/FindLibSoup2.cmake
@@ -63,6 +63,11 @@
INCLUDE( FindPkgConfig )
+IF ( LibSoup2_FIND_VERSION AND NOT LIBSOUP2_MIN_VERSION AND NOT LIBSOUP24_MIN_VERSION )
+ SET( LIBSOUP2_MIN_VERSION "${LibSoup2_FIND_VERSION}" )
+ SET( LIBSOUP24_MIN_VERSION "${LibSoup2_FIND_VERSION}" )
+ENDIF ( LibSoup2_FIND_VERSION AND NOT LIBSOUP2_MIN_VERSION AND NOT LIBSOUP24_MIN_VERSION )
+
IF ( LibSoup2_FIND_REQUIRED )
SET( _pkgconfig_REQUIRED "REQUIRED" )
ELSE( LibSoup2_FIND_REQUIRED )
@@ -89,14 +94,14 @@ IF ( LIBSOUP24_MIN_VERSION )
ENDIF ( LIBSOUP24_MIN_VERSION )
# try to find any version of libsoup2.4 if LIBSOUP22_MIN_VERSION is not set
-IF ( NOT LIBSOUP24_FOUND AND NOT LIBSOUP22_MIN_VERSION )
+IF ( NOT LIBSOUP24_FOUND AND NOT LIBSOUP22_MIN_VERSION AND NOT LIBSOUP24_MIN_VERSION )
PKG_SEARCH_MODULE( LIBSOUP24 libsoup-2.4 libsoup2 )
-ENDIF ( NOT LIBSOUP24_FOUND AND NOT LIBSOUP22_MIN_VERSION)
+ENDIF ( NOT LIBSOUP24_FOUND AND NOT LIBSOUP22_MIN_VERSION AND NOT LIBSOUP24_MIN_VERSION )
# try to find any version of libsoup2.2 if LIBSOUP24_MIN_VERSION is not set
-IF ( NOT LIBSOUP22_FOUND AND NOT LIBSOUP24_MIN_VERSION )
+IF ( NOT LIBSOUP22_FOUND AND NOT LIBSOUP24_MIN_VERSION AND NOT LIBSOUP24_MIN_VERSION )
PKG_SEARCH_MODULE( LIBSOUP22 libsoup-2.2 libsoup2 )
-ENDIF ( NOT LIBSOUP22_FOUND AND NOT LIBSOUP24_MIN_VERSION)
+ENDIF ( NOT LIBSOUP22_FOUND AND NOT LIBSOUP24_MIN_VERSION AND NOT LIBSOUP24_MIN_VERSION )
# set LIBSOUP2_ variables
IF ( LIBSOUP24_FOUND )
@@ -115,7 +120,7 @@ ELSEIF ( LIBSOUP22_FOUND )
ELSEIF( PKG_CONFIG_FOUND AND LibSoup2_FIND_REQUIRED )
# raise an error if both libs are not found
# and FIND_PACKAGE( LibSoup2 REQUIRED ) was called
- MESSAGE( SEND_ERROR "package libsoup2 not found" )
+ MESSAGE( FATAL_ERROR "package libsoup2 not found" )
ENDIF ( LIBSOUP24_FOUND )
IF( NOT LIBSOUP2_FOUND AND NOT PKG_CONFIG_FOUND )
--
WebKit Debian packaging
More information about the Pkg-webkit-commits
mailing list